The Struggle of Forgiveness and Self-Identity in 'Can You Forgive Her'

Finntroll's 'Can You Forgive Her' delves into the emotional turmoil of a man grappling with love, betrayal, and self-identity. The song opens with a vivid depiction of sleepless nights and physical symptoms of anxiety, suggesting the protagonist is deeply affected by his feelings. The lyrics convey a sense of shame and pain, as the man feels humiliated by his lover's actions and public ridicule. This emotional conflict is heightened by the realization that there is truth in her criticisms, making the situation even more painful.

The chorus poses a critical question: Can he forgive her if she asks for it? This question is not just about forgiveness but also about his ability to meet her expectations and demands. The lyrics explore the complexity of forgiveness, hinting at the possibility of revenge but ultimately dismissing it as childish. This internal struggle reflects a broader theme of maturity and the difficulty of moving past hurtful experiences.

The song also touches on themes of nostalgia and lost innocence. The protagonist reminisces about youthful dreams and past relationships, highlighting how these memories continue to influence his present feelings. The reference to being easily led and the vivid imagery of past romantic encounters underscore the lasting impact of early love and betrayal. The song suggests that these formative experiences shape one's ability to forgive and move on, making the process even more challenging.

Ultimately, 'Can You Forgive Her' is a poignant exploration of the complexities of love, forgiveness, and self-identity. It captures the emotional depth of human relationships and the struggle to reconcile past experiences with present realities.
